    won·der
    /ˈwəndər/

    noun

    • 1. a feeling of surprise mingled with admiration, caused by something beautiful, unexpected, unfamiliar, or inexplicable: "he had stood in front of it, observing the intricacy of the ironwork with the wonder of a child" Similar aweadmirationwondermentfascination

    verb

    • 1. desire or be curious to know something: "how many times have I written that, I wonder?" Similar ponderask oneselfthink aboutmeditate on
    • 2. feel doubt: "I wonder about such a marriage"
